thanks mate:) on your grey pipe you appear to have a piece that the airline slips on too, mine just has a hole? is there a nipple thingy on yours or is the airline pushe in the hole? thanks

hihat
12-08-07, 19:07
My airline pushes onto a small pipe coming off the side of the top pipe, the lower section of pipe has a hole in it which the collar can cover (or not) to adjust the air intake of the skimmer, this is visible on the 3rd and 4th pics on the thread.

Is yours the needle wheel version? as the venturi version probably has a different set up.
